"Hunts are best measured by the endurance of the memories they produce," E. Donnall Thomas Jr. writes in this, his first collection of waterfowling essays. He might have added that good books are likewise measured by how vivid, and how long, they remain in the mind of the reader. By Dawn's Early Light is a book that will stay with you long after you have read it. Though he has pursued big game, upland birds, and a variety of fish all over the world, Thomas reserves a special place in his heart for duck and goose hunting, That's because waterfowling is to him a uniquely American sport. A sport of home and hearth, of memories made even more poignant by the knowledge that the first light of dawn is fleeting and will not last. Thomas captures these moments so well that his memories become ours. (5 3/4 x 8 3/4, 200 pages, illustrations)
